That chart and that picture are both from the website of a person named Saoto Tsuchiya. He runs an Etsy store called SaotoTech where he sells aftermarket 3D-printed TrackPoint caps, and has released CAD data for the “soft rim” (concave) version of the “Super Low Profile” (4mm) TrackPoint cap.

I prefer SaotoTech’s aftermarket TrackPoint caps to Lenovo’s TrackPoint caps. This is because Lenovo only offers TrackPoint caps in the “soft dome” (convex) shape, and no longer offers the “soft rim” shape. The “soft rim” shape requires less force to manipulate the cursor, which in my opinion, makes it more comfortable to use. Here is a visual comparison of the TrackPoint cap shapes.

The existence of these aftermarket caps is proof that nobody needs to depend on Lenovo parts to implement a pointing stick.
